1) Nominating Cobalion for A- Rank:
Cobalion has quite a few roles on a team, either as a Swords Dance Sweeper, A Stealth Rocker, Taunter, In Volt Turn teams, etc. While you might say base 90 attack is a bit low. It still has a lot of traits. It's typing makes it neutral to Psychic, it has base 129 Defense and base 108 Speed. So it's really fast and it is also pretty Physically Bulky. The reason I think it should be nominated for A- is because it can come in on the likes of Umbreon, Chansey and pretty much set up on their face. I particularily use the Swords Dance+ Lum Berry Combination, it gets stuff like Swagger users like annoying ass Liepard and it also helps vs walls that may try to status me like Chansey (if they carry T-Wave), Porygon2, Florges, etc. With Lum it pretty much negates that and lets me get up another Swords Dance, pretty much if you get up 2 SD's, you're gonna sweep with your Cobalion. I personally consider it a pretty damn good underrated pokemon, and it since it's UU , it's not completely overshadowed by Lucario. It's steel typing allows it to hit common Fairy Types like Florges, Gardevoir, Slurpuff, Granbull , etc.
I'll show you guys a few calcs with Cobalion:
+2 252 Atk Cobalion Close Combat vs. 252 HP / 252+ Def Suicune: 199-235 (49.2 - 58.1%) -- 62.9% chance to 2HKO after Leftovers recovery
+2 252 Atk Cobalion Close Combat vs. 252 HP / 252+ Def Eviolite Chansey: 806-950 (114.4 - 134.9%) -- guaranteed OHKO
+2 252 Atk Cobalion Close Combat vs. 252 HP / 252+ Def Lanturn: 306-360 (67.4 - 79.2%) -- guaranteed 2HKO after Stealth Rock and Leftovers recovery
Cobalion pretty much leaves a mark on any pokemon after a Swords Dance which that, and it pretty good Physically Defensive prowess made me think to dominate it to A- Rank at least.
2) Nominating Chansey for A- Rank:
This might seem weird, but from my experiences with Chansey, sometimes it completed it's role, but most of the time it ended up being total and complete set up fodder. The other thing thing I don't really like about is that it needs Eviolite to work, otherwise it becomes completely useless. And with Knock Off just about being everywhere, this blob really needs to keep the Eviolite or it will be dead-weight. The other thing I don't really like about it is that it is Normal type. Normal Type is bad for Chansey, because most Fighting type moves are Physical and Chansey has super lackluster defense. It will pretty much get forced out and you will grant your opponent a free oportunity to set up like a Swords Dance, A Sub, or a set up move. And also there are a lot of fighting type Pokemon in UU, it kind of makes me avoid using it. Heracross, Mienshao, Hawlucha are all really common and they just shit on Chansey. Also if Chansey comes against a Ghost , it can't do anything about it as it only gets Seismic Toss as it's only attacking move. So that's why I think it should go A-. It's not bad, but it has those issues which keep it from being as effective as it used to be. Chansey would also appreciate Lefties recovery, which it can't get because it is forced to run Eviolite, pretty much.
I pretty much agree with what you said about Cobalion. What I want to add is how it fucks with usual checks to SD fighting types. Its Steel STAB allows it to easily beat Florges and Granbull, the go to fighting counters after Knock Off buff. With lum berry attached, Cofagrigus, Mew and Rotom-N all fail to burn it and are 2HKOed in return. Crobat can't do much to it thanks to its seconary steel tying and great bulk. While it is somewhat weak to comnob regenge killers (Victini, Mienshao, Krookodile), it can really shine against slower teams
. A- Rank seems good for it.
However, I really disagree with you on Chansey. In fact, I think it shold rise a rank to
A+ as the single best mixed wall bar none.
On Knock Off, there is actually only one common Knock Off user named Empoleon that Chansey is supposed of walling (Chansey is not completely safe from Tornadus-T anyway). Knock Off or not, Chansey is never taking on Crawdaunt or Mienshao or Mega Absol, or else it will be broken even in Ubers lol. In reality, a good stall team wil always have something to take Knock Offs (Mega Aggron, Blastoise etc). Even if its Eviolite is Knocked Off, it is NOT deadweight at all. It can no longer wall physical attackers but its special bulk is just less than Blissey for a tiny bit.
252 SpA Choice Specs Hydreigon Draco Meteor vs. 252 HP / 4 SpD Chansey: 297-349 (42.1 - 49.5%) -- guaranteed 3HKO
252+ SpA Mega Launcher Mega Blastoise Aura Sphere vs. 252 HP / 4 SpD Chansey: 282-334 (40 - 47.4%) -- guaranteed 3HKO
252+ SpA Choice Specs Chandelure Fire Blast vs. 252 HP / 4 SpD Chansey: 306-361 (43.4 - 51.2%) -- 5.9% chance to 2HKO
252 SpA Life Orb Sheer Force Nidoking Focus Blast vs. 252 HP / 4 SpD Chansey: 317-374 (45 - 53.1%) -- 30.5% chance to 2HKO
Even the strongest special attackers can't manage to 2HKO itemless Chansey.
252 SpA Life Orb Latias Psyshock vs. 252 HP / 252+ Def Chansey: 300-355 (42.6 - 50.4%) -- 1.2% chance to 2HKO
252 Atk Jirachi Iron Head vs. 252 HP / 252+ Def Chansey: 216-255 (30.6 - 36.2%) -- 52.7% chance to 3HKO
252 Atk Krookodile Earthquake vs. 252 HP / 252+ Def Chansey: 301-355 (42.7 - 50.4%) -- 1.2% chance to 2HKO
It can still take relatively powerful physical hits as well.
Being a nornal type is not anything bad for something as bulky as Chansey. It never needs resistance to wall virtually every special attacker and many physical attackers reliably. Having only a single weakness is great, even better when fighting is primirily a physical attacking type, making it really hard to break on the special bulk (only NP Togetic breaks it lol). While Fighting types are buffed with Knock Off, they are actually less common than last gen and fighting resists like Cofagrigus, Granbull, Florges, Slowbro all pairs well with Chansey. I personally use physically defensive Doublade with Rest, which walls every fighting type INCLUDING Scrafty to hell and back even with Knock Off with 252+ Knock Off deals 36% max. Chansey really doesn't need much support and the support needed is usually essential for stall already.
Lacking leftovers is quite bad, but its bulk more than compensates for it. Lacking leftovers never stopped Mega Venusaur from being S Rank in UU. Chansey is even harder to wear down thanks to much more reliable recovery and pseudo immunity to status. Lacking leftovers is more or less compensated by its great bulk.
Chansey's assess to Softboiled is also a perk. Unlike Vaporeon and Florges, Chansey is not forced to stay in for 2 turns in order to recover health, potentially giving many sweepees easy set up. With Wish + Softboiled, it can pass huge wishes to teamates while immediately recovering health.
Another thing is that its Wish and cleric support is appreciated by many pokemon that cover up its weakness. Mega Aggron, Doublade, Mega Blastoise are all excellent pokenons that cover up Chansey well but have no recovery and are prone to status. Chansey doesn't really need to be supported specifically. In return, it provides invaluable support to a team to a point that even bulkier offensive teams can possibly fit in it. It is deserving of A- Rank.
